Page 4 EN 689 : 1995 O Introduction Assessing occupational exposure to air contaminants in a representative way is a challenging task. It is necessary how,ever to gather information, evaluate and minimize exp
17、osure to chemical agents. Industrial processes and agents are countless. Each manufacturing stage may apply different conditions (e.g. batch production or continuous process, temperature, pressure) and agents (e.g. a wide variety of chemical substances); in each of these stages different job functio
18、ns may be necessary and be subject to different exposure conditions. Distance to emission sources and physical parameters such as rates of release, air current, meteorological variations, have also a profound influence. The resulting variability of exposure conditions is made even grater by individu
19、al practices. All this explains why rapid fluctuations in contaminant concentration or large variations over very small distances are commonplace: site, moment and duration of sampling are decisive. Some measurements on a given day or period may give an insufficient view of the actual variability of
20、 individual polluted-air exposure characteristics. The sampling equipment often introduces its own limitations, sometimes critical, as in aerosol fractions assessments, and the analytical steps add further difficulties or uncertainties, e.g. insufficient identifica- tion or separation of chemical sp
21、ecies, or interferences. In this complex context, sampling strategy is responsible for representativeness at the lowest possible cost. In this variety of situations and difficulties, assessments may be undertaken with very different motives, purposes, and practices. Schemes and guidelines are offere
22、d to harmonize basic concepts and actions. In order to guarantee the quality of assessments and, if necessary, to improve work conditions, pro- fessional judgment has to be exercised. 1 Scope This European Standard gives guidance for the assessment of exposure to chemical agents in workplace atmosph
23、eres. It describes a strategy to compare workers exposure by inhalation with relevant limit values for chemical agents in workplace and measurement strategy. 2 Normative references This European Standard incorporates by dated or undated reference, provisions from other publications.
